triggerman
[ trig-er-muhn, -man ]
/ ˈtrɪg ər mən, -ˌmæn /
Save This Word!
noun, plural trig·ger·men [trig-er-muhn, -men]. /ˈtrɪg ər mən, -ˌmɛn/. Informal.
a gangster who specializes in gunning people down.
a bodyguard, especially of a gangster.
